ABSTRACT:
The invention relates to a process for determining the starting capacity of a starter battery of a motor vehicle for which the mean value for the voltage surge during the starting of an internal combustion engine, is determined as a function of mean values for the battery and engine temperatures, compared with the voltage surge values of a characteristic line field which records determined voltage surges as a function of corresponding battery and engine temperatures, a deviation of the actually determined voltage surge from the voltage surge stored in the characteristic line field is determined and compared to a preassigned value, and an indicator or an alarm is triggered as soon as the preassigned value is exceeded.
